Address

ecash:qqqjpdgw78v2n0wva6qrusauptdnrs5npq0tfychccCopy

Total Received

6025749.65 XEC

Total Sent

6025749.65 XEC

№ Transactions

96

Final Balance

0 XEC

Transactions
Filter